CBT ChatBot Assist
CBT ChatBot Assist is a modern psychological counseling program dedicated to students, designed to support you in moments when you feel overwhelmed by anxiety, stress or lack of motivation. This program brings together two essential ingredients: the support provided by psychologists within group sessions and an artificial intelligence chatbot that helps you put into practice what you have learned between sessions.
Conceptually, the CBT ChatBot Assist Program is based on the transdiagnostic intervention protocol proposed by David Barlow (Barlow et al., 2011), a scientific method internationally recognized for its effectiveness in addressing difficult emotions – whether we are talking about anxiety, sadness or stress.
The program includes four group psychological counseling sessions, conducted in a safe, relaxed and confidential setting. In these meetings you will learn concrete strategies for managing negative thoughts, regulating emotions and developing healthier behaviors. Everything is designed to be applicable in a student’s daily life.
Between sessions, you will have access to an intelligent ChatBot, integrated into a mobile application, that provides you with continuous support: it helps you organize your exercises, monitor your emotions, receive personalized feedback and stay connected to the personal development process. All at your own pace, whenever you need it.
Important to know: The ChatBot does not replace human counselors, but complements them. Think of it as a “personal assistant” that supports you between sessions, encourages you, reminds you why it is important to continue and offers you suggestions tailored to your needs.
CBT ChatBot Assist was developed with the financial support of the Faculty of Sociology and Psychology (FSP) of UVT.
